Community & Support

Assign taxonomy terms to users?

Hi,

I've got a bit of a unique requirement I think.

A site I'm working on has several subsections that contain news, events, and other content on a particular subject related to the sites main topic.

Users need to be able to either:

a) have the subsection(s) they are interested in assigned to them by an admin.

b) pick the subsection(s) they are interested in in their profile

Making things a bit more complicated, one of the member roles (a kind of junior member - membership on the site is paid only) can only have one subsection associated with it at any time. The other roles can pick and choose / have multiple subsections assigned as need be.

The purpose is to allow update emails to be sent out with content that the users are going to be interested in (i.e. tailored to their choice of subsection) as well as enabling access to forums associated with that section, and just showing in the members profile what they are interested in.

I'd really appreciate any insight you guys can give as to how to achieve this, as its the last big issue on this project. If I can solve this one it's just a matter of populating the site and I'm done! :-D

Big thanks to anyone who can help

Rich

Comments

Modules

There is a User Tags module for assigning taxonomy to a user. There is also an Interests module that helps users build up an interests list. Check the Downloads tab above and then Modules. There is a list by category there; one of those categories is "Taxonomy."

Nancy W.
Drupal Cookbook (for New Drupallers)
Adding Hidden Design or How To notes in your database

Thanks

Yeah I tried User Tags but it:

a) Threw a php error on the user profile page

b) From what I read it allowed users to free tag their profiles, rather than from a set? Could be wrong as I never got to use it ;-)

Interests sounds...erm...interesting though! I'll take a look. Thanks for your help :-)

Not quite

Yeah, Interests is cool, but its not quite right. Doesn't allow choosing of interests, just automatically assigns them according to what you visit, which is kind of the opposite of what I want.

Ta for the suggestion though, and I might use it on a future project as it sounds great for a social network thing.

My need is also for specified

My need is also for specified roles to assign taxonomy terms to users, and not necessarily allow users to change this. I'm looking to assign different types of status to users and thought this would be the module for that but not quite. If anyone has suggestions on how to do this, please let me know.

Thanks. subscribing

User Terms

nobody click here